Courses for experienced learners
There are 3 courses available in Kalgoorlie-Boulder Western Australia for experienced learners with prior experience or qualifications.
Diploma of Retail Leadership
- There are no mandated entry requirements.


Certificate IV in Retail Management
- Completed Certificate III in Retail or equivalent qualifications OR
- Evidence of relevant skills, knowledge and employment experience








Diploma of Retail Merchandise Management
- There are no mandated entry requirements.

Customer Service Representative
Customer Service Representatives assist clients with product enquiries, take orders, resolve complaints, and manage customer data through calls, emails, or chat.
Retail Assistant
A Retail Assistant supports customers in shops or department stores by answering inquiries, processing payments, and monitoring stock levels.
Retail Team Leader
A Retail Team Leader supervises staff, ensures sales goals are met, and provides excellent customer service while resolving issues.
Store Manager
A Store Manager oversees retail operations, managing staff, finances, and customer service while handling advertising and resolving issues.
Cashier
A Cashier processes payments, provides receipts, balances cash, and ensures adequate change while delivering excellent customer service.
Car Salesman
Car Salesmen assist customers in purchasing vehicles, providing advice, demonstrating features, organising finance, and processing transactions.
Retail Supervisor
A Retail Supervisor oversees a retail team, ensuring sales targets are met, resolving issues, and assisting customers when needed.
Retail Manager
A Retail Manager supervises store operations, manages staff and budgets, ensures compliance, and focuses on sales and customer service.
Area Manager
An Area Manager oversees operations within a specific region, managing teams, finances, and customer service to ensure effective performance.
Regional Manager
A Regional Manager oversees operations across multiple branches in a specified area, focusing on efficiency, profits, and effective leadership.
Retail Executive
A Retail Executive manages retail operations, sets sales targets, analyses profits, and engages in marketing and strategic planning.
Cluster Manager
A Cluster Manager oversees daily operations across multiple stores, ensuring profitability, effective service, strong leadership, and problem-solving.
E‑commerce Assistant
An E-Commerce Assistant manages online products, orders, and content to support sales and ensure a smooth digital shopping experience.

The Certificate IV in Retail Management SIR40316 is designed for those eager to solidify their foundational skills in management practices within the retail sector. Alternatively, the Diploma of Retail Merchandise Management SIR50317 provides a more advanced understanding of merchandise strategies, equipping you with the skills needed to make impactful decisions in your department. Lastly, the Diploma of Retail Leadership SIR50116 focuses on leadership development, allowing you to inspire and manage teams effectively.
